WWE Promises SummerSlam Will Finish Early

Ever since the announcement that WWE would be running SummerSlam in Las Vegas on the same night as the Pacquiao vs Spence Jr boxing match, people have been wondering how the event would fare.

We appear to have our answer per the Wrestling Observer, as WWE will be ending SummerSlam early to accommodate fans who will be travelling to the fight. Dave Meltzer writes:

Different WWE sources have said that WWE has promised key people in Las Vegas that the show would end early in order to give people time to get to the Manny Pacquiao vs. Errol Spence Jr., fight. We were also told this directly from WWE. One source listed 11 p.m. Eastern (8 p.m. local time) as the promised end time for the show and another said 11:30 p.m., but the idea was Pacquiao-Spence would start at around midnight and even though the two buildings are 1.4 miles apart, the traffic would be insane on a Saturday night on the strip at that time and they promised fans at their show would be able to get into the arena for the boxing match by the time the ring introductions for the main event took place. Three hours is okay, probably even preferable, for a regular monthly show, but it is on the short side for one of the three big events of the year.

WWE SummerSlam 2021 streams live on the WWE Network or Peacock in the United States on Satuday, August 21, 2021.
